Orlando Pirates legend Eugene Zwane has explained why Sunday’s Betway Premiership Soweto Derby between the Buccaneers and Kaizer Chiefs carries more weight than recent encounters.
The two giants of South African football will lock horns at a sold-out FNB Stadium, with kick-off scheduled for 15:00.
Both sides come into the much-awaited Soweto Derby affair in good form. Pirates are unbeaten in their last eight matches, while Amakhosi have put together a formidable six-game unbeaten run of their own.
Currently, the Sea Robbers sit at the summit of the Betway Premiership table with 58 points after 25 outings. The Abdeslam Ouaddou-led side holds a slender one-point lead over defending champions Mamelodi Sundowns, who have a game in hand.
Meanwhile, Chiefs are enjoying a resurgence, occupying the third spot with 46 points from 24 games.
‘THIS SOWETO DERBY HAS THAT ADDED FLAVOUR’: EUGENE ZWANE
Zwane believes the current log positions have reignited the belief within both fanbases, making this particular fixture a high-stakes affair.

“This one is a top-of-the-table Soweto Derby, which has not happened many times in the recent past. So, this one has the added flavour of being a top-of-the-table derby,” Zwane told FARPost.
“I mean, Pirates are number one, and Chiefs now seem to be cementing their place in third position. So, there is a lot at stake. Some Kaizer Chiefs supporters still believe they could push for the league title, and all of these elements, you know.
“Pirates are pushing hard to dethrone Mamelodi Sundowns. There is just so much excitement about this Soweto Derby that we haven’t seen in recent times.”
EUGENE ZWANE DESCRIBE SOWETO DERBY AS A CONTINENTAL SPECTACLE
The football legend further noted that the magnitude of this weekendโs clash has transcended South African borders, capturing the attention of the entire continent.
“I think the whole continent is talking about it [the Soweto Derby]. Itโs no longer a South African thing; it is now a continental thing,” he added.
“You see, building up to this derby, Nigerian pundits, Mozambican pundits, and Zimbabwean pundits have so much to say about it. It has become an African spectacle, and everyone is looking forward to it.”
